body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}#root,body,html{background-color:#fafafa;font-family:Arial,sans-serif;height:100%;margin:0;overflow:hidden;padding:0}header{align-items:center;background:#f0f0f0;border-bottom:1px solid #ddd;display:flex;gap:10px;justify-content:flex-end;left:0;padding:10px 20px 10px 10px;position:fixed;top:0;width:100%}input{border:1px solid #ccc;border-radius:4px;padding:8px}button{background-color:#4caf50;border:none;border-radius:4px;color:#fff;cursor:pointer;font-weight:700;padding:8px 16px;transition:background-color .2s ease}button:hover{background-color:#45a049}button.secondary{background-color:#888}button.secondary:hover{background-color:#666}.main-container{align-items:center;display:flex;flex-direction:column;height:calc(100vh - 60px);justify-content:center;margin-top:60px;text-align:center}h1,h3{margin:10px 0}.recipe-list{margin-top:20px;text-align:left;width:300px}.recipe-list ul{list-style:none;padding:0}.recipe-list li{background:#fff;border:1px solid #ddd;border-radius:4px;margin-bottom:8px;padding:10px}.login-form{display:flex;gap:10px;margin-right:30px}.search-form{display:flex;flex-direction:column;margin-top:20px;width:300px}.message{color:#333;margin-top:10px}.register-form{display:flex;flex-direction:column;gap:10px;margin:0 auto;max-width:300px}.register-form button,.register-form input{font-size:16px;padding:8px}
/*# sourceMappingURL=main.aaefdee1.css.map*/